Crane and Tower Operators salary
United States, all industries · BLS OEWS 2025
National market range
$53K–$83K
Median
$68,080
25th percentile
$52,600
75th percentile
$83,200

Source: BLS OEWS, 2025 · Ranges are 25th–75th percentile of reported wages for the occupation code · All workers, regardless of gender.
Women are 28% of material moving occupations nationally, and earn 86¢ for every dollar men earn (U.S. Census ACS 2024; earnings full-time year-round). A market-based target is computed the same way regardless of gender — that’s the point.
